如何来人工智能公司

如何来人工智能公司

如何来人工智能公司

掌握核心技术、积累项目经验、学习商业思维、建立专业网络。为了详细回答其中的一点,我们将重点探讨掌握核心技术。人工智能公司对技术人才的需求极高,掌握核心技术如机器学习、深度学习、自然语言处理等,是进入该行业的关键。通过学习这些技术并在实际项目中应用,能够大幅提升竞争力。

一、掌握核心技术

1. 学习基础理论

进入人工智能公司首先需要扎实的基础理论知识。重点学习的课程包括线性代数、微积分、概率论与数理统计、计算机科学基础等。这些课程为理解机器学习和深度学习等复杂算法打下坚实的基础。

2. 掌握编程技能

编程是人工智能领域的基本技能。Python由于其丰富的库和简洁的语法,成为了AI领域的首选语言。掌握Python语言的基本语法、数据结构、面向对象编程等,是进行人工智能项目开发的基础。此外,还需要熟悉R、Java、C++等其他编程语言。

3. 深入学习机器学习和深度学习

机器学习和深度学习是人工智能的核心。可以通过在线课程、书籍和实际项目来深入学习这些领域。推荐的学习资源包括Coursera上的Andrew Ng的机器学习课程、Deep Learning Specialization、以及经典书籍《Pattern Recognition and Machine Learning》、《Deep Learning》等。

4. 实践项目经验

通过实际项目来应用所学知识是掌握技术的关键。可以通过参加开源项目、实习、竞赛等途径积累项目经验。Kaggle是一个非常好的平台,可以参加各种机器学习竞赛,解决实际问题,并与同行交流学习。

二、积累项目经验

1. 参与开源项目

开源项目是一个绝佳的学习和展示平台。通过参与开源项目,不仅可以提高自己的编程能力,还可以与其他开发者合作,学习他们的代码和思路。GitHub是目前最大的开源项目托管平台,可以在上面找到各种与人工智能相关的项目。

2. 参加实习

实习是进入人工智能公司的重要途径。通过实习,不仅可以了解公司的实际运作,还可以积累宝贵的工作经验。寻找实习机会时,可以通过公司官网、招聘网站、职业社交平台等途径。

3. 参加竞赛

人工智能竞赛是展示自己能力的好机会。Kaggle、天池等平台上有很多高质量的竞赛,通过参加这些竞赛,可以解决实际问题,提升自己的技术水平。此外,竞赛的成绩也是求职时的一个重要加分项。

三、学习商业思维

1. 理解行业应用

人工智能技术在各行业的应用场景广泛,包括金融、医疗、零售、制造等。深入了解这些应用场景,理解人工智能如何为企业创造价值,是非常重要的。可以通过阅读行业报告、参加行业会议等方式获取相关信息。

2. 学习商业模式

了解公司的商业模式,包括盈利模式、客户群体、市场策略等,是进入人工智能公司前需要准备的内容。通过学习商业模式,可以更好地理解公司的运作和发展方向,从而更好地融入公司。

3. 提升沟通能力

沟通能力是职场中非常重要的软技能。人工智能项目往往需要跨部门合作,因此,提升自己的沟通能力,能够更好地与团队成员协作,推动项目进展。可以通过参加沟通技巧培训、阅读相关书籍等方式提升自己的沟通能力。

四、建立专业网络

1. 参加行业会议和论坛

行业会议和论坛是建立专业网络的好机会。通过参加这些活动,可以结识行业内的专家和同行,了解最新的技术发展和应用趋势。此外,还可以通过这些活动获取实习和工作机会。

2. 加入专业社交平台

LinkedIn是一个非常好的职业社交平台,可以通过该平台展示自己的专业技能和项目经验,结识同行和潜在雇主。此外,还可以通过该平台获取行业资讯和求职机会。

3. 参与社区活动

技术社区是一个非常好的学习和交流平台。可以通过参与社区活动,如线下沙龙、技术分享会等,结识志同道合的朋友,交流学习心得,获取最新的技术资讯。推荐的社区包括机器学习社区、数据科学社区等。

五、准备求职材料

1. 制作专业简历

简历是求职过程中的重要工具。简历应简洁明了,突出自己的核心技能和项目经验。可以通过简历模板、职业指导等方式制作一份专业的简历。此外,还可以制作一份在线简历,如个人网站、GitHub主页等,展示自己的项目和代码。

2. 准备求职信

求职信是求职过程中的重要补充材料。求职信应简洁明了,突出自己的求职动机、核心技能和项目经验。可以通过求职信模板、职业指导等方式制作一份专业的求职信。此外,还可以通过求职信展示自己对公司的了解和兴趣,增加求职成功的几率。

3. 准备面试

面试是求职过程中的重要环节。可以通过模拟面试、面试题库等方式准备面试。此外,还可以通过了解公司的面试流程和常见问题,提前做好准备。面试过程中,应注重展示自己的专业技能和项目经验,突出自己的优势和亮点。

通过以上几个方面的准备,可以大幅提升进入人工智能公司的几率。希望这些建议能够帮助你成功进入心仪的人工智能公司,实现职业梦想。

相关问答FAQs:

1. 人工智能公司的招聘要求是什么?

  • 人工智能公司通常会要求应聘者具备良好的编程技能和算法知识,熟悉机器学习和深度学习等相关领域。
  • 具备数据分析和数据处理能力,能够处理大规模数据集并提取有用的信息。
  • 具备团队合作能力和沟通能力,能够与不同背景的团队成员合作,共同解决问题。
  • 拥有相关经验或项目经验会是一个加分项。

2. 如何准备自己来应聘人工智能公司?

  • 学习和掌握编程技能,如Python、Java等,可以通过在线教育平台或参加相关的培训课程来提升自己的能力。
  • 深入了解机器学习和深度学习的基本原理和算法,可以阅读相关的书籍或参加相关的课程。
  • 参与相关的项目或实习经验,通过实际操作来提升自己的能力和经验。
  • 关注行业动态和最新技术发展,了解人工智能领域的前沿技术和应用场景。

3. 人工智能公司的面试流程是怎样的?

  • 一般来说,人工智能公司的面试流程包括初试、复试和终试三个阶段。
  • 初试通常是通过电话或在线面试的方式进行,主要考察应聘者的基本技能和知识背景。
  • 复试阶段可能包括笔试、编程测试和技术面试等环节,考察应聘者的具体能力和解决问题的能力。
  • 终试阶段可能包括面试官面试、技术面试和HR面试等环节,主要考察应聘者的综合素质和团队合作能力。

注意:请根据实际情况自行调整FAQs的内容和顺序。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/122518

(0)
Edit1Edit1
上一篇 2024年8月12日 下午1:04
下一篇 2024年8月12日 下午1:04
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部